The incident occurred around 10 p.m. on Tuesday when the gunmen stormed the town and fired several gunshots into the air, creating fear and confusion among residents.
Sources said four people, including Farounbi, were initially taken by the attackers, but security personnel and local volunteers stationed in the community confronted the gunmen, leading to a fierce exchange of gunfire.
The resistance reportedly forced the attackers to release three of the captives, while Farounbi was taken away.
Residents who spoke to PUNCH said the gunmen appeared to have targeted specific individuals and fired repeatedly before carrying out the abduction.
One resident, who pleaded for anonymity for security reasons, said the attackers had already moved the victims toward a nearby forest before security forces intervened.
The resident said, “Four people, two Fulani women and two men including the Ifedayo Local Government Vice Chairman, Debo Farounbi were abducted. But the resistance put up by the military made the perpetrators to abandon three people.
“The however went away with Farounbi. Our people did not sleep throughout the night. We are in serious fear. The incident happened around 10pm on Tuesday.”
Confirming the incident, the spokesperson for the Osun State Police Command, Abiodun Ojelabi, said only one person, Farounbi, was still being held.
“One person was abducted. He is a local government Vice Chairman, Hon Debo Farounbi. Immediately the incident happened, the military, police and others responded. Efforts are in place to rescue the man. It is abduction until we are able to prove that it is a case of kidnapping,” Ojelabi said.
